Output 63a18d93388245788e6d022bd30b0ca2de346dd73b7cab934dba8984826fa1f2:0

value
30554868
script pubkey
OP_0 OP_PUSHBYTES_20 9ca37412ec40831bf3ffcefb7105a7e060c2e6e2
address
ltc1qnj3hgyhvgzp3hullemahzpd8upsv9ehz0eplq8
transaction
63a18d93388245788e6d022bd30b0ca2de346dd73b7cab934dba8984826fa1f2
spent
true